dominick: the "Extra Mile" bonus is what you paid $99 for - I think - I did it last year - where you get 50% bonus miles on each flight up to some maximum like 10,000 if I remember right. This is not the same as the e-ticket bonus others are talking about.

Earn up to 15,000 OnePass Miles when you fly from June 1 through August 15,2001. Than you for enrolling in OnePass. Because your satisfaction is our goal, we're presenting this special offer to give you a head start on earning reward travel ... we'll give you 3,000 OnePass bonus miles for taking your first round-trip flight as a OnePass member and 1,500 bonus miles each for your second and third trips. Purchase your e-tickets online and we'll more than double your bonus miles! ... purchase your etickets at continental.com and ... you'll receive 7,000 bonus miles when you fly your first roundtrip and 4,000 bonus miles each for your second and third roundtrips for a total of 15,000 bonus miles.

Anyway, the promotion code is GG ONE RA9946 (bottom right of page). "Qualifying flights must be purchased through a published fare. For example, tickets sold through COOL Travel Specials, Priceline and Hotwire are not eligible." Also, this offer is "in lieu of the publicly advertised 1,000 bonus mile eTicket offer."
The cover has "FLY ONCE, TWICE OR THREE TIMES. . . And earn up to 15,000 OnePass bonus miles." The address bar code has the standard pre-sort ZIP info and OnePass Account Number (no other special codes). The return address is OPSC (RCHOP) in Houston. This promotion appears to be targeted and automatic (no registration necessary for flagged accounts), but I will call OPSC anyway to double-check.
